Ketones are cleaved oxidatively by Cr(VI) or Mn(VIII) reagents. The reaction is sometimes of utility in the synthesis of difunctional molecules by ring cleavages. The mechanism for both reagents is believed to involve reaction of an enolic intermediate, although in neither case have all the details been established. A study involving both kinetic data and accurate product-yield determination has permitted a fairly complete description of the Cr(VI) oxidation of benzyl phenyl ketone (desoxybenzoin). Nickel prepared by reduction of nickel chloride with sodium borohydride was used for desulfurization of diethyl mercaptole of benzil. Partial desulfurization using 2 mol of nickel per mol of the mercaptole gave 71% yield of ethylthiodesoxybenzoin while treatment with a 10-fold molar excess of nickel over the mercaptole gave 61% yield of desoxybenzoin (benzyl phenyl ketone) 937. ... [Pg.131]

The alkylthio group in an aromatic ketone may be removed with Raney Ni without affecting the carbonyl group. Thus, treatment of desyl thioethers (a-alkylthiodesoxy-benzoins) with Raney Ni, which had been deactivated by refluxing in acetone,149 gave desoxybenzoins in yields of 55-90% (eq. 13.73).150... [Pg.613]

Desoxybenzoins. Benzoins are reduced to desoxybenzoins by treatment with red phosphorus and iodine in carbon disulfide containing pyridine (3.5 hr., 25°). Presumably an a-iodo ketone is formed as an intermediate. This deoxygenation has been carried out also with hydriodic acid (1,449). [Pg.470]

The acid-catalysed Fischer indole synthesis is an electrophilic substitution, and the evidence suggests that it occurs less readily with pyridylhydrazones than with benzene derivatives. Some failures with derivatives of 2-pyridyl-hydrazine have been recorded but cyclohexanone and desoxybenzoin 2-pyridylhydrazones were cyclized in about 50 per cent yields with poly-phosphoric acid.
